What Cheddar's Scratch Kitchen Actually Is

The chain operates as a scratch-cooking casual-dining restaurant where most dishes are prepared to order rather than assembled from pre-made components. The kitchen approach centers on controlling ingredient quality and cooking method; burgers are formed fresh daily, steaks are cut in-house, and sauces and dressings are made on-site. The restaurant occupies a middle ground: faster and less formal than a traditional steakhouse, but with a built-from-scratch kitchen model that distinguishes it from counter-service operations. Oklahoma City locations seat 100 to 150 diners in a casual, booth-and-table setup designed for both quick lunches and family dinners.

Menu and Pricing

Entrees range from $9 to $18, with burgers and sandwiches occupying the lower end and steaks, seafood, and combination plates at the higher tier. The signature burger ($12 to $14) comes with a half-pound fresh beef patty, customizable toppings, and choice of side; the chicken fried steak ($11) is breaded and fried in-house, served with mashed potatoes and gravy. Appetizers (bone-in wings, fried pickles, queso dip) run $6 to $10. A key menu feature is the side customization: instead of a preset plate composition, diners choose two sides from options including mac and cheese, French fries, coleslaw, sweet potato fries, and seasonal vegetables, allowing specific preference matching without substitution fees. Lunch specials typically discount sandwiches and burgers by $2 to $3 during weekday hours; verify current promotions by phone or website since meal-deal timing and specific dishes change seasonally.

Who It Suits and Who It Does Not Suit

Cheddar's works well for families with children, office workers on lunch breaks, and diners seeking filling meals under $20 without sacrifice of preparation quality. The made-to-order model accommodates dietary preferences: gluten-free bun substitution is available, vegetarian sides compose a complete plate, and the kitchen accepts modifications without attitude. The restaurant does not suit diners seeking upscale plating, chef-driven seasonal menus, or a quiet ambiance; the casual dining room generates moderate noise, and the menu remains consistent rather than reflecting seasonal ingredient availability. It is also less ideal for those prioritizing locally sourced ingredients or sole-proprietor ownership.
